Kawasaki Ki-45 Toryu: from heavy fighter to night-time B-29 hunter

In 1937 the Imperial Japanese Army, watching Europe field twin-engine “destroyers” such as the Messerschmitt Bf 110, issued a requirement for a long-range twin-engine heavy fighter. Kawasaki’s answer, first flown in January 1939, was underpowered and troubled — its Nakajima Ha-20 engines never delivered. Only after a thorough redesign, re-engined with Nakajima Ha-25 and then Mitsubishi Ha-102 radials and reborn as the Ki-45 KAI, did the aircraft come good. It entered service in 1942 and drew its name Toryu — “Dragon Slayer” — and, from the Allies, the reporting name “Nick.”

As a heavy fighter the Toryu proved a flexible workhorse. It escorted bombers and intercepted them, flew anti-shipping strikes, strafed and bombed ground targets, and hunted lumbering B-24 Liberators over China, Burma, New Guinea and the Philippines. Some variants carried a hand-loaded 37 mm cannon; one experimental version mounted a 75 mm gun. Where nimble single-seat fighters struggled to carry heavy weapons and fuel, the two-seat Toryu could.

Its defining chapter came late. When the B-29 Superfortress began raiding Japan in 1944, the Ki-45 became the Army’s principal home-defence night fighter — by most accounts the only Japanese Army night fighter to see significant action. The definitive KAI Hei carried a nose 37 mm cannon and a pair of obliquely-mounted, upward-firing 20 mm cannon, the same idea as the Luftwaffe’s Schräge Musik, letting a Toryu slide beneath a bomber and fire up into its belly.

As B-29s flew higher and faster, and as radar sets never arrived in reliable numbers, interception grew desperate. Some units turned to taiatari — deliberate ramming. Of roughly 1,700 Toryu built, exactly one complete aircraft survives today, at the Smithsonian: the last Dragon Slayer.

01The Kawasaki Ki-45 Toryu’s troubled birth: why the first design nearly failed

The original Ki-45 was a disappointment. Its Nakajima Ha-20 engines were underpowered and unreliable, the nacelles created drag, and performance fell short of the Army’s hopes. Rather than abandon the concept, Kawasaki’s team — led by Takeo Doi — reworked the aircraft almost completely: cleaner nacelles, better cooling, and progressively more powerful radials, first the Nakajima Ha-25 and finally the Mitsubishi Ha-102 of roughly 1,050–1,080 hp each. The rebuilt Ki-45 KAI (“modified”) flew in 1941 and reached squadrons in 1942. The lesson of the Toryu is that its success was not in the first design but in the willingness to fix it.

02The Kawasaki Ki-45 Toryu’s oblique cannon: Japan’s answer to Schräge Musik

The definitive night fighter, the Ki-45 KAI Hei (Model C), mounted two 20 mm cannon obliquely in the upper fuselage, angled upward and forward. The tactic mirrored the Luftwaffe’s Schräge Musik installations: rather than chase a bomber into the fire of its tail and dorsal guns, the fighter formed up in the bomber’s blind spot below and behind, then raked the wings and fuselage from beneath. Against the B-29 — heavily defended and fast — getting into that position at night was the hard part, but when it worked the oblique guns were devastating. A nose-mounted 37 mm cannon gave the same aircraft a heavy forward punch.

03The Kawasaki Ki-45 Toryu as night fighter: hunting the B-29 in the dark

When XX Bomber Command opened the strategic campaign against Japan in June 1944, the Army had no purpose-built night fighter ready — so it pressed the Toryu into the role. Dedicated night-fighter Sentai defended the industrial heartland, the Kanto plain and the approaches to Tokyo. Early results against B-29s flying at medium altitude were encouraging; the type’s top B-29 killer, Captain Isamu Kashiide of the 4th Sentai, was credited with a large personal tally (claims that, as with all such figures, exceed confirmed losses). But the plan depended on radar that never arrived in numbers, and as the B-29s switched tactics and pressed home low-level fire raids, the ageing Toryu was increasingly overwhelmed.

Kawasaki Ki-45 Toryu: full specifications

Baseline note: the figures below describe the Ki-45 KAIc (Army Type 2 Two-Seat Fighter Model Hei; "Nick" to Allied intelligence), the mark built in the largest numbers and the one that flew the night defence of the Home Islands. Deltas for the earlier KAIa and for the failed 1939 Ki-45 prototypes are in grey. One correction before the tables: the gross weight of 8,820 kg that appears in several widely copied reference tables is a transcription error — it is the empty weight of 4,000 kg re-expressed in pounds and then relabelled. The KAIc weighed 5,500 kg loaded, which is what the same tables’ own wing loading of 171.9 kg/m² actually implies.

Dimensions & weights

Crew
2 — pilot, and a rear crewman who was gunner, radio operator and, on the KAIb, the man who hand-loaded a tank gun between passes. The KAId deleted the rear machine gun but kept the second man
Length
11.00 m (36 ft 1 in)
Wingspan
15.02 m (49 ft 3 in); Japanese airframe tables give 15.07 m (49 ft 5 in). The 50 mm gap is a measuring convention, not a change of mark
Height
3.70 m (12 ft 2 in)
Wing area
32.00 m² (344 sq ft); Japanese sources 32.20 m² (347 sq ft)
Aspect ratio
7.05 — a long, high-aspect wing built for range, which is why the aeroplane was a good bomber-killer and a poor dogfighter
Aerofoil
NACA 24015 at the root, NACA 23010 at the tip
Empty weight
4,000 kg (8,818 lb); the lighter KAIa was 3,695 kg (8,146 lb)
Loaded weight
5,500 kg (12,125 lb); KAIa 5,276 kg (11,632 lb). Japanese tables for the Ki-45 KAI generally quote 5,270 kg, which is the KAIa figure
Wing loading
171.9 kg/m² (35.2 lb/sq ft) — heavy for 1942 and utterly conventional for a twin, but carried on two engines of only 1,080 hp apiece
Power loading
2.55 kg/hp (5.61 lb/hp) on take-off power. A Ki-43 managed about 2.2 kg/hp; the difference is the whole argument about whether the Toryu was a fighter
Internal fuel
Not consistently published in the accessible literature. The quoted 2,000 km range on two Ha-102s implies something over 1,000 l in wing tanks, but no primary figure is offered here because none could be corroborated
External stores
Two underwing hardpoints, each rated for a 250 kg (551 lb) bomb or a 200 l (44 imp gal) drop tank
Structure
All-metal stressed-skin low-wing monoplane, flush-riveted, with a retractable tailwheel undercarriage. The KAI was not a modified Ki-45 but a new airframe that borrowed the basic design of Kawasaki’s own Ki-48 twin-engined light bomber

Performance

Maximum speed
540 km/h (336 mph, 292 kn) at 6,000 m (19,685 ft); the lighter KAIa reached 547 km/h (340 mph) at 7,000 m (22,965 ft)
Speed as flown
Lower. Japanese unit accounts are explicit that service aircraft, with worn engines and wartime finish, did not make the catalogue figure — and 540 km/h was already below the 1937 requirement the type was ordered against
Cruising speed
350 km/h (217 mph) at 3,000 m (9,840 ft), the figure carried in Francillon and repeated by most Western tables
Rate of climb
11.7 m/s (2,300 ft/min) initial
Time to 5,000 m
7 min 0 sec (to 16,400 ft)
Service ceiling
10,000 m (32,810 ft); the KAIa is credited with 10,730 m (35,200 ft), and the difference is armament weight, not altitude capability
Performance where the B-29 flew
This is the row that decided the type’s career. A B-29 bombing from 9,000–10,000 m (30,000–33,000 ft) sat at the Toryu’s absolute ceiling. Climbing there took the best part of half an hour, arrived with almost no speed margin over a bomber cruising at 350 km/h, and left the pilot one wallowing pass with mushy controls
Range
2,000 km (1,243 miles, 1,080 nmi); KAIa 2,260 km (1,404 miles). Japanese tables give 1,500 km for the KAI, which is a combat rather than a ferry figure
Power-to-weight
0.285 kW/kg (0.17 hp/lb) at loaded weight
Take-off and climb
Rated Good by American testers who flew the captured aircraft at Wright Field — a short run and a respectable climb were the type’s genuine virtues
Ground handling
Rated Very poor in the same American report, the worst mark the aeroplane received for anything. Taxiing, take-off and landing directional control were all bad
Handling in the air
Rated Good to Excellent for control and manoeuvrability at normal speeds; high-speed manoeuvrability, workmanship and equipment were all judged inferior to American practice. Persistent complaints: a cramped cockpit, poor view from it, and heavy vibration

Propulsion & systems

Engines
Two Mitsubishi Ha-102 (Navy designation MK2D Zuisei 21) 14-cylinder two-row air-cooled radials driving three-blade constant-speed metal propellers
Engine dimensions
28.0 l (1,710 cu in), bore and stroke 140 × 130 mm (5.5 × 5.1 in), 1,118 mm (44.0 in) diameter, 540 kg (1,190 lb) dry — one of the smallest 14-cylinder engines built anywhere
Power ratings
1,080 hp (805 kW) for take-off at 2,700 rpm; 1,055 hp at 2,800 m (9,190 ft) in low blower; 950 hp at 5,800 m (19,030 ft) in high blower
Supercharger
Single-stage geared centrifugal. Japanese power tables quote two distinct full-throttle heights, which implies a two-speed drive; some Western engine listings describe the Zuisei as single-speed. The two-speed reading is the one the Japanese figures support
Fuel
87 octane, with a compression ratio of 6.5 — a low-grade fuel that capped what the engine could ever be asked to do at height
Earlier engines
Two Nakajima Ha-20 Otsu of 820 hp on the 1939 prototypes (underpowered and chronically unreliable), then two Nakajima Ha-25 of 1,000–1,050 hp on the 1940 pre-production machines
Nacelles
The original Ki-45 suffered nacelle stall, the flow off the engine cowlings separating the airflow over the wing upper surface. Kawasaki cured it on the KAI by moving the nacelles below the wing chord line — the single most important change in the whole programme
Exhaust
Collector rings on early aircraft; individual ejector stacks fitted to late night-fighter production for a small thrust gain, with flame damping that mattered more
Radio
Army radio-telephone. Unusually for Japanese practice it worked, and the 4th Sentai built its whole B-29 interception method around it: the commander directing the fight by voice from a ground command post
Radar
None in service. The Taki-2 airborne set was tested on the Ki-45 KAIe prototype, and a single KAIc is recorded as radar-fitted; production could not deliver, and the centimetric nose set intended for the night-fighter mark never arrived. Ground control, searchlights and the crew’s eyes did the work instead
Protection
Thin by 1944 standards: some armour for the crew, no comprehensive tank protection, and no system that would keep a wing on after a burst of 12.7 mm from a B-29 turret
Undercarriage
Retractable main gear and tailwheel. The retraction system was one of the named defects of the 1939 prototypes and took two redesigns to become dependable
04The Kawasaki Ki-45 Toryu’s cost: why no reliable price survives

The Toryu was a wartime product of the Japanese state, built for the Imperial Japanese Army and never traded on any open market. No dependable flyaway unit price — in yen or dollar-equivalent — survives in the public record, and no credible cost-per-flight-hour figure exists for the type. Any precise number attached to a Ki-45 today should be treated as an estimate at best. What can be said is that the twin-engine Toryu was more expensive and material-hungry than a single-seat fighter, one reason Japan also fielded cheaper single-engine interceptors alongside it.


Armament & payload

The Toryu was rearmed four times, and every change was an admission that killing a bomber needs a bigger gun than killing a fighter

No Japanese aircraft of the war had its guns swapped about so often or so revealingly. The Ki-45 began in 1942 with a fighter’s battery — two 12.7 mm in the nose and a single 20 mm in a ventral tunnel — discovered within months that this would not bring down a B-17, and answered by bolting an infantry tank gun into the belly that the rear crewman reloaded by hand, one round every thirty seconds. The proper answer arrived with the Ho-203, a genuine 37 mm automatic in the nose, and the aeroplane finally became what the Army had wanted all along: a mobile heavy gun. The last change was the cleverest and the least Japanese-sounding — two 20 mm Ho-5 mounted behind the cockpit and canted upwards, so that a night fighter could sit in a bomber’s blind spot beneath it and shoot into the wing roots without ever entering the arc of a single defensive turret. Gun fits varied by mark, by batch and by depot rework, and Japanese, American and Western reference sources disagree over which suffix carried what; the account below follows the Japanese variant literature where the three conflict.

Gun

  • KAIa (Ko): two 12.7 mm Ho-103 in the nose (12.7 × 81SR, up to 900 rounds/min unsynchronised, firing the Ma-103 fuzed and Ma-102 fuzeless high-explosive incendiary rounds), one 20 mm Ho-3 in a ventral tunnel offset to starboard (20 × 125, 43 kg, 820 m/s, only 300–400 rounds/min, drum-fed, descended from the Type 97 anti-tank rifle), and one 7.92 mm Type 98 on a flexible mount in the rear cockpit
  • KAIb (Otsu): the ventral 20 mm replaced by a 37 mm tank gun taken from the Type 95 light tank. Devastating on impact and almost useless in practice — the rear crewman worked the breech by hand and the aircraft could manage roughly one round every thirty seconds, in practical terms two shots per firing pass. Japanese sources name it the Type 98 37 mm tank gun; English-language sources usually say Type 94. Both weapons existed and both armed the Type 95; the Japanese attribution is the better-documented one
  • KAIc (Hei): one 37 mm Ho-203 automatic cannon in the nose — 89 kg, 570 m/s, 120 rounds/min, a 475 g projectile, a long-recoil automation of the Year 11 Type infantry gun. Magazine capacity is disputed: a 25-round closed-loop belt in general references, 16 rounds in the Ki-45 installation according to others. The ventral 20 mm Ho-3 was restored alongside it
  • The oblique pair: two 20 mm Ho-5 (20 × 94, 37 kg, 750 m/s, about 750 rounds/min, belt-fed, developed from the Ho-103) mounted between the pilot’s and rear seats and canted upwards and forwards. Trialled first as the Tei-soubi or "Tei fit" on existing KAIc airframes with the ventral Ho-3 removed to compensate for the weight, then standardised as the KAId, on which the rear flexible gun was also deleted. Early conversions used Ho-103 machine guns in the oblique mounting before Ho-5 supply allowed the change to 20 mm
  • Experimental and small-batch nose guns: the 37 mm Ho-204 (a belt-fed, higher-velocity, far better 37 mm than the Ho-203); the 40 mm Ho-301 firing caseless ammunition at 245 m/s with an effective range of about 150 m, fitted to the KAIe alongside Taki-2 radar; and the 57 mm Ho-401, whose Ki-45 installation was in effect the prototype of the Kawasaki Ki-102b

Air-to-air

  • No guided air-to-air weapon existed in Japanese service at any point, and none was ever projected for the Toryu. The guns were the entire battery and the tactics were built around them
  • The oblique installation deserves stating carefully, because the popular account is wrong in both directions. It was not a German import: the Imperial Japanese Navy arrived at upward-firing cannon independently, on Commander Kozono Yasuna’s initiative at the 251st Kokutai, and a field-modified J1N1 shot down two B-17s over Rabaul on 21 May 1943. Nor did it predate the German work — Rudolf Schoenert was experimenting with upward-firing guns from 1941, the first installation went into a Do 17Z-10 late in 1942, and his first Schräge Musik victory came the same month as Kozono’s. The two lines of development were genuinely independent and very nearly simultaneous
  • The Army copied the Navy, not the Germans. Japanese accounts are explicit that the Ki-45’s oblique guns followed directly from the Navy’s results at Rabaul from May 1943, reaching the Toryu as a field fit and then as a production standard during 1944
  • Type 3 air-to-air bombs: phosphorus and shrapnel weapons dropped into a bomber formation from above and fuzed to burst among it. The Ki-45 is among the aircraft best attested to have used them, and one B-29 lost over Yawata on 20 August 1944 is credited to air-to-air bombing in American records
  • Ramming. It belongs in this card because by late 1944 it was a doctrine rather than a desperate improvisation: on 7 November 1944 the 10th Air Division ordered each subordinate sentai to form a four-aircraft air-to-air special attack flight, named Shinten Seikutai by General Prince Higashikuni Naruhiko. The Western District’s 12th Air Division called its equivalents Kaiten-tai

Air-to-surface guided

  • None carried, none projected, and none existed. Japan fielded no operational air-to-surface guided weapon of any kind for a fighter airframe during the war
  • The Toryu did the anti-shipping job the hard way, with a 37 mm cannon at low level against small craft and a pair of 250 kg bombs against anything larger, and it did that job better than it did any other
  • The card is kept for consistency across this encyclopedia. The honest entry is that the category was empty for every Japanese combat aircraft of the period bar a handful of trials weapons that never reached a unit

Bombs

  • Two 250 kg (551 lb) bombs on underwing racks — the standard load for the ground-attack and anti-shipping work in China, Burma and New Guinea, and the reason some units called the aeroplane the Type 2 Twin-Engined Ground-Attack Aircraft rather than a fighter at all
  • Smaller loads of anti-personnel and fragmentation bombs were carried on the same racks against airfields and troop concentrations
  • Type 3 air-to-air bombs against B-29 formations, released from above — a low-probability weapon that nonetheless killed at least one bomber
  • No dive brakes, no bombsight worth the name in the rear cockpit, and no pretension to accuracy above low level. This was a strafing aeroplane that also happened to carry bombs

Rockets

  • No rocket armament is attested on operational Ki-45s. The card is kept and the entry is honest: this is a gun aeroplane
  • The Imperial Japanese Army’s air-to-air rocket work went to other airframes and never produced a weapon that reached a Toryu unit
  • What filled the same tactical niche — a heavy, short-range punch delivered in one pass — was the 37 mm nose cannon and, at the extreme, the 40 mm Ho-301, which with its 245 m/s muzzle velocity and 150 m effective range was closer to a rocket launcher than to a gun

Pods & other stores

  • Two 200 l (44 imp gal) drop tanks on the underwing racks, alternative to the bombs — the fit that made the 1942 long-range escort role possible at all
  • Taki-2 airborne radar on the KAIe prototype and a single recorded KAIc. It never entered service, and the centimetric nose set promised for the night-fighter mark was defeated by Japanese electronics production
  • A handful of one-off conversions carried radio direction-finding equipment or beacon receivers for night navigation and recovery — a partial substitute for the radar that never came
  • Exhaust flame dampers on night-fighter aircraft; no ejection seats, no drop-tank jettison sophistication, no external gun pods of any kind
  • The Shinten ramming aircraft carried nothing at all. Guns, armour plate and radio were all stripped out, producing what Japanese crews called a muteikoki, a "no-resistance aircraft", worth a few hundred metres of extra ceiling

Three typical loadouts

Anti-shipping strike, New Guinea, 1943
One 37 mm in the ventral tunnel or nose, one 20 mm Ho-3, the rear 7.92 mm manned, and two 250 kg bombs under the wings. Flown at low level against barges, PT boats and coastal shipping. This is the mission the Toryu was actually good at, and the one its crews liked
Night interception over the Kanto plain, spring 1945
One 37 mm Ho-203 in the nose, two 20 mm Ho-5 canted upward behind the cockpit, ventral gun and usually the rear gun removed, exhaust flame dampers fitted, no external stores. Vectored by ground control and searchlight, closing from below and behind a B-29 running in at 1,500–3,000 m on a LeMay incendiary raid — the one tactical situation in which this aeroplane held every advantage
Shinten ramming sortie, winter 1944–45
Nothing. A worn-out airframe with the cannon, armour and radio removed, four such aircraft to a sentai, climbing above 9,000 m to strike a B-29 with a wing or a propeller. The pilots were expected to bail out and come back; two men of the 244th Sentai’s Hagakure flight rammed twice each and survived both times

Sourcing caveat: the mark-to-armament mapping for the Hei and Tei is genuinely contested. English-language references commonly place the oblique cannon on the KAId only; Japanese variant literature and the Smithsonian’s own catalogue entry for the surviving airframe put them on Hei-built aircraft with the "Tei fit", which was then formalised as the KAId. English Wikipedia acknowledges the conflict in its own text. Ammunition capacities for the Ho-203 and the Ho-3 vary between sources by a factor approaching two.


Variants

Kawasaki spent four years failing to build this aeroplane, then built it twice

The Ki-45 is one of the longest and least dignified development programmes of the Japanese aircraft industry. Ordered in December 1937 in the wake of the Bf 110 and the Potez 630, first flown in January 1939, it was still not in service when the Pacific War began — four years from specification to squadron, against a requirement it never actually met. Two things killed the first aeroplane: the Nakajima Ha-20 Otsu engine, which was both underpowered and unreliable, and nacelle stall, in which flow off the engine cowlings separated the air over the wing and took the lift with it.

Re-engining with the proven Ha-25 in 1940 fixed the power and not the stall, and eight promising pre-production machines were still refused. What finally worked was giving up. Kawasaki abandoned the Ki-45 airframe altogether and designed a new one around the basic layout of its own Ki-48 light bomber, hanging the nacelles below the wing chord line, and it is this aircraft — the Ki-45 KAI, adopted in February 1942 — that everyone means by "Toryu". Even the name came late: it was lifted in November 1944 from an Army citation to Lieutenant Colonel Shindo Tsuneemon for the Philippines campaign, and released to the newspapers as a morale story.

Ki-38 (1937 / mock-up only)
Kawasaki’s first answer to the Army’s twin-engined two-seat fighter study. Never built beyond a wooden mock-up; the Army ordered a flying prototype instead in December 1937
Ki-45 prototypes (1939–40 / six aircraft, 45.01–45.06)
Two Nakajima Ha-20 Otsu of 820 hp. First flight January 1939. Successive cowling changes and even ducted cooling spinners lifted the top speed only to about 480 km/h against a requirement near 540 km/h; unreliable undercarriage and persistent nacelle stall stopped the programme in late 1939
Ki-45 re-engined (1940 / six to eight aircraft, 45.07–45.12)
Nakajima Ha-25 of 1,000–1,050 hp in tight NACA cowlings, chief designer changed from Ichimachi Isamu to Doi Takeo. Flew well from July 1940 and was still rejected: the nacelle stall was unsolved. Sources differ over whether seven or eight were completed
Ki-45 KAI (1941 / two prototypes plus about twelve pre-production)
The new airframe on Ki-48 lines with Mitsubishi Ha-102 engines, ordered October 1940. Sources place the first flight in May 1941 and the definitive prototype’s completion in September 1941; adopted as the Army Type 2 Two-Seat Fighter in February 1942
Ki-45 KAIa (Ko, 1942 / main early production)
Two 12.7 mm Ho-103 in the nose, one 20 mm Ho-3 ventral, one flexible 7.92 mm aft. The escort fighter that was beaten by P-40s over Guilin and Hanoi in 1942 and was then sent to do something else
Ki-45 KAIb (Otsu, 1942–43 / roughly twenty aircraft)
Ventral 20 mm replaced by a hand-loaded 37 mm tank gun to deal with the B-17. Two shots a pass. Also the mark that made the type’s reputation as a low-level ground-attack and anti-shipping aircraft in China, Burma and New Guinea
Ki-45 KAIc (Hei, April 1944–45 / 477 aircraft)
The definitive mark. Automatic 37 mm Ho-203 in the nose, ventral 20 mm Ho-3 restored, rear gun retained. Most were later given, or built with, the oblique 20 mm "Tei fit" with the ventral gun removed
Ki-45 KAId (Tei, 1944–45)
The Tei fit made a production standard: nose 37 mm plus two obliquely mounted 20 mm Ho-5, rear flexible gun deleted. This is the night fighter of the home-defence sentai, and it was meant to have a centimetric nose radar that Japanese industry never delivered
Ki-45 KAIe (Bo, 1944–45 / prototype only)
Taki-2 airborne radar and one 40 mm Ho-301 caseless-ammunition cannon in the fuselage. Both halves of the idea failed: the radar was not producible and the gun could not reach further than 150 m
One-off conversions (1944–45 / single figures)
Nose installations of the 37 mm Ho-204 and the 57 mm Ho-401, the latter effectively the prototype of the Ki-102b; direction-finder and beacon-receiver fits for night work; and engine and intake modifications intended to make 9,000 m a usable operating altitude rather than a ceiling
Ki-45-II (1943 / redesignated)
A single-seat development with 1,500 hp Mitsubishi Ha-112-II engines. So different that the Army renumbered it the Ki-96, from which came the Ki-102 in high-altitude fighter, ground-attack and night-fighter forms and the pressurised Ki-108. The Ki-102 was to have replaced the Toryu and had not done so by August 1945
Foreign and post-war users (1945–early 1950s / a handful)
No licence production and no wartime export beyond nominal Manchukuo Air Force association. Three Ki-45s fell into Chinese Communist hands after the surrender and, unusually for captured Japanese aircraft, were assigned to the 1st Squadron of the Combat Flying Group in March 1949 and flown on operations before retirement in the early 1950s

Production totals are given as 1,690 or 1,691 by Green and Swanborough, 1,701 by Francillon and 1,704 in Japanese sources; the differences are prototypes and pre-production airframes counted in or out. On survivors, the common statement that no Ki-45 survives is not quite right and the common statement that one complete aircraft survives is not right either. The National Air and Space Museum holds one airframe, brought to the United States aboard USS Barnes with about 145 other Japanese aircraft, overhauled at Middletown Air Depot and flight-tested at Wright Field and NAS Anacostia before being donated to the Smithsonian in June 1946. Its fuselage — complete with the oblique cannon mounting behind the cockpit — is on public display at the Steven F. Udvar-Hazy Center; the wings, engines and remaining components exist but are held disassembled in storage and are not exhibited. No Ki-45 anywhere is assembled, and none has flown since the 1940s. Beyond that airframe there are relics rather than aircraft: a Ha-102 engine and propeller raised from the seabed off Oarai and displayed at the Mito Tsubasa-no-To park on the site of the Mito Army Flying School, and the engine and fragments of a Toryu that rammed a B-29 over the Kanto plain, recovered from a field in Chiba prefecture. The rows of abandoned 71st Independent Chutai machines photographed at Kallang in Singapore in September 1945 were all scrapped.

Taiatari

The first ram over Japan

On 20 August 1944, Sergeant Shigeo Nobe deliberately rammed a B-29.

Read the full story
During the Yawata raids of 20 August 1944, Sergeant Shigeo Nobe of the 4th Sentai — with gunner Sergeant Denzo Takagi — radioed that he would ram, then flew his Toryu into a B-29. Falling debris is credited with downing a second bomber. Both crewmen were killed. It is remembered as the first deliberate ramming over the Home Islands.

What does “Toryu” mean?
“Toryu” (屠龍) translates as “Dragon Slayer” or “Dragon Killer.” The Allied reporting name for the aircraft was “Nick.”
Why was the Ki-45 called “Nick”?
“Nick” was the Allied reporting name assigned to the type under the system that gave Japanese fighters male first names. It has no meaning beyond identification.
Was the Ki-45 a good night fighter?
For a stopgap, yes — it was the only Japanese Army night fighter to see significant action against the B-29, and its oblique 20 mm cannon could be devastating. But it depended on radar that never arrived reliably, and it was progressively outpaced as the B-29s flew higher and faster.
Did Ki-45s really ram B-29s?
Yes. As conventional interception faltered, some crews carried out taiatari — deliberate ramming. Sergeant Shigeo Nobe’s ram on 20 August 1944 is remembered as the first over the Home Islands, and dedicated ramming flights were later formed within home-defence units.
What were the oblique cannon?
The night-fighter KAI Hei carried two 20 mm cannon mounted obliquely in the upper fuselage, firing upward and forward — the same idea as the Luftwaffe’s Schräge Musik — so a fighter could attack a bomber from below its defensive guns.
How many Ki-45s were built, and do any survive?
Roughly 1,700 were built between 1939 and 1945 (figures commonly range from about 1,675 to 1,701). Exactly one complete aircraft survives today, at the Smithsonian’s Udvar-Hazy Center.
